    Sampler size sample. A very nice IPA, poured with the usual color and a nice head and lacing. The aroma was strong grapefruits and citrus rinds. The flavor was grapefruits and citrus rinds along with a significant pine presence, quite strong in the hopping with enough malt balance to support it underneath (although I can't attribute much of the flavor to the malts). Mouthfeel was on par, fairly smooth.

    Simply put: Awesome. Ranks right up there with the best IPAs I've ever had. Served in a standard pint, came a hazy gold/orange with a finger of foam, with great retention. Aroma is powerful, some nice sweet but backgrounded malt, and hops galore; citric grapefruit, orange rind, and strong resinous pine flavors. Flavor starts with some malt sweetness, mixed with some strong hop sweetness. Tangerine, crushed pine needles, grapefruit rind, and some lemon hints come in a rush of bitterness. Finishes a little dry, with a longlasting bitter citric aftertaste. As I said, awesome. A hopheads wet dream
